Early biochemical predictors of sepsis in patients with burn injury: current status and future perspectives
TL;DR: Roles of current biomarkers in early diagnosis of sepsis in burn patients are clarified and a combination of markers may be suggested for a more accurate diagnosis.

Intrapleural and Intraperitoneal Free Fluid in Calcium Channel Blocker Overdose
Mustafa Yilmaz,Mehmet Oğuzhan Ay,Yüksel Gökel,Nalan Kozaci,Gulnihal Samanlioglu,Mesude Atli,Seda Nida Karakucuk +6 more
TL;DR: Besides the cardiovascular findings, intraperitoneal and intrapleural free fluid is also a common feature in CCB overdose, and bedside USG may help to identify these patients.
